KENDAL Town Council had to cancel their Christmas lights switch-on due to the adverse weather conditions.

Storm Arwen had torn through the streets this morning moving cross street signs as well as the 28ft Christmas tree in its anchor hole.

The lights were due to be switched on at 4.45pm alongside music from Stagecoach, Kendal Youth Zone, and Drum Nation.

Town mayor Cllr Doug Rathbone said: "It is such a disappointment after last year's Covd-hit low key affair, but public safety is our paramount concern."
